Toxicity of aqueous root extract of Cochlospermum planchonii (an anti-malarial herb) in selected tissues of mice

Comparative Clinical Pathology, 2012
Aqueous root extract of Cochlospermum planchonii, an acclaimed anti-malarial herb was investigated for toxicity in selected tissues of mice at the doses of 50, 100, and 250 mg/kg body weight. Twenty Swiss albino mice were completely randomized into four groups: A–D consisting of five animals each.

N’Dribala (Cochlospermum planchonii) versus chloroquine for treatment of uncomplicated Plasmodium falciparum malaria

Journal of Ethnopharmacology, 2003
The aim of this work was to assess the efficacy of oral N'Dribala (tuberous roots decoction of Cochlospermum planchonii Hook) treatment versus chloroquine in non-severe malaria. The hepatoprotective cytochrome P-450 enzyme inhibitor isolated from the Nigerian medicinal plant Cochlospermum planchonii is a zinc salt

Journal of Ethnopharmacology, 1995
Aqueous extracts of Cochlospermum planchonii Hook.f. (Cochlospermaceae) rhizomes are used by native medical practitioners in northern Nigeria to treat jaundice.
